About the Book

Essays in this festschrift, brought out in honour of Professor K.S. Chalam, are highly specialized, covering the four states of southern India. These are the analytical essays on the history and socio-economic transformation of the marginal communities or disprivileged groups, i.e., Dalits, tribes and other occupational communities. The essays focus on these social categories and reflect on economic development, and the process of social change.

Professor Chalam is a trained economist, specialized in broader themes like economics of education, political economy, public economics and Dravidian studies. Perhaps he is one of the few economists, who has widely written, over four decades, on education and the disprivileged – an issue that has re-emerged and has been intensely debated in recent years.

He has pioneered some innovative ideas in his interdisciplinary studies like ‘Education and Weaker Sections’ two decades ago when there were very few serious works drawing from history, economics, education, sociology and related disciplines. Therefore, this volume has been planned in such a way that the essays incorporate all his cherished ideas.

About the Author / Editor

Yagati Chinna Rao is Associate Professor at Programme for the Study of Discrimination and Exclusion (PSDE), School of Social Sciences, Jawaharlal Nehru University, New Delhi. He has held the position of Member Secretary, Indian Council for Historical Research (ICHR), New Delhi, and has also been Visiting Fellow at the Centre for South Asian Studies, University of Edinburgh, Scotland. His earlier works include: “Dalits’ Struggle for Identity” (2003); “Dalit Studies: A Bibliographical Handbook” (2003); “Writing Dalit History and Other Essays” (2007); also co-edited (with S. Bhattacharya et al.) “Development of Women’s Education in India, 1850-1921: Selections from Documents” (2001) and “Educating the Nation: Documents on the Discourse of National Education in India, 1880-1920” (2003).
